Photosensitivity is the amount to which an object reacts upon receiving photons, especially visible light. In medicine, the term is principally used for abnormal reactions of the skin, and two types are distinguished, photoallergy and phototoxicity.

Isotretinoin is arguably the best treatment we have for severe acne. It does come with possible side effects, including photosensitivity. The sun also increases your risk of skin cancer and causes premature aging. So, using sunscreen every day is a skin-healthy habit even if your acne treatment.

Sunscreens containing physical blockers, such as zinc oxide and/or titanium dioxide, are recommended as a preventive measure against sun sensitivity. Drugs Associated With Photosensitivity Reactions Antibiotics Doxycycline (Vibramycin and others) Ciprofloxacin, Levofloxacin Minocycline Tetracycline Sulfonamides

Antibiotics It's not just topical medications that can make you more sensitive to the sun. Certain oral medications, like oral antibiotics, can do the same. Doxycycline is the most likely to cause photosensitivity, but tetracycline, minocycline, and erythromycin can too.
